SPECIAL CONDITIONS <br /> The Subrecipient agrees to comply with the requirements of Title XII of the American Recovery <br /> and Reinvestment Act of 2009, Public Law 111-5 (Recovery Act) that established the Homeless <br /> Prevention and Rapid Re-housing Program, as published on March 19, 2009, and as amended <br /> from said date and all federal regulations and policies issued pursuant to these regulations. The <br /> Subrecipient further agrees to utilize funds available under this Agreement to supplement rather <br /> than supplant funds otherwise available. <br /> VII. GENERAL CONDITIONS <br /> A. General Compliance <br /> The Subrecipient agrees to comply with all applicable federal, state and local laws and <br /> regulations governing the funds provided undei�this contract. <br /> B.
